## Configuration

The Hallward Audio Guide app reads its settings from a `.env` file at the repo root. Most values have sensible defaults: `GUIDE_LOCALE` controls the default narration language, `TOUR_CACHE_TTL` sets how long exhibit audio manifests are cached, and `STREAM_BITRATE` caps playback quality on gallery Wi-Fi. The only value without a default is the signing secret used to authorize downloads from the Penn Cove media server. Add it to your env file on the next line:

sealed setting: ARCHIVE_KEY3=8d0

Subject: Transcode farm cut-over — done!

Hi, welcome aboard! Quick recap: we moved the Finchreel transcoding farm onto the new worker pool over the weekend. Queues drained cleanly, and the old nodes are parked for a week just in case. If a job looks stuck, check the pool first. The workers currently run with these settings.

config for tafog-yawep:
OLIAEL_HOST=oliael.tolvaqsys.internal
OLIAEL_PORT=6379

Handover note — Crumbwheel order cutoffs.

Welcome aboard. The bakery cutoff rule in Crumbwheel closes same-day orders at 14:00 local to each storefront, not UTC — this has bitten us twice. Holiday overrides live in the calendar service and take precedence silently, so always check there first when a cutoff looks wrong. To unlock the calendar service's admin console after a restart, enter the recovery passphrase below.

vault phrase of bagap-bahaf = silion-pelox-sorox-casdor-quenwyn-fraax-eliox-praael-kelion-quenvan-kasox-rusael-norius-belvan